ABOUT VAYNERMEDIA:

VaynerMedia is a contemporary global creative and media agency with an expertise in driving relevance for clients and delivering impactful business results. The independently-owned agency was founded in 2009 and has offices in New York, Los Angeles, London, Singapore and Mexico City. VaynerMedia has been recognized for its work at Cannes Lions, the Clio Awards and The Webby Awards. It is part of the VaynerX family of companies.

The Role

We’re looking for someone who can help architect, write, and scale Gary Vaynerchuk’s Substack as a thought-leadership and culture hub. The ideal candidate is a writer-strategist hybrid who lives and breathes storytelling, audience growth, and platform psychology.

You’ll build out Gary’s Substack presence: Shaping the content strategy, growing the subscriber base, and connecting it to the broader ecosystem of video and social content.


What You’ll Do
  • Lead Substack strategy & growth: Own the publishing schedule, tone, and distribution strategy for Gary’s Substack.
  • Research, write & edit: Turn Gary’s ideas, interviews, and content into high-impact Substack content to build engagement and grow the subscriber base.
  • Interviewing: Interview Gary to extract his insights and produce original content.
  • Driving subscribers: Collaborate with the creative and platform teams to distribute Substack stories, and drive more subscribers. Come up with creative growth strategies.
  • Analyze & iterate: Go beyond surface metrics: Draw insights from engagement data and reader behavior to guide concepts we publish and frequency. Understand user behavior on the platform deeply.
  • Stay ahead of the curve: Keep tabs on Substack and newsletter best practices, algorithm updates, and emerging content patterns. Balance doing what works and what’s proven, and experimenting with things no one else is doing. 
You Might Be a Fit If You…
  • Have proven experience writing or editing for Substack, newsletters, or editorial brands that grew to meaningful audiences.
  • Have excellent long-form and short-form writing skills.
  • Have a deep understanding of Gary’s message and personal brand. Understand what he talks about, and how he talks about it.
  • Understand social strategy: You know how content performs differently on Substack, X, TikTok, LinkedIn, and YouTube, and can promote content contextually for the platform.
  • Are analytical and creative. Equally comfortable dissecting data dashboards and crafting an opening paragraph that hooks.
  • Are deeply curious. Curiosity translates to what you want to hear Gary should talk more about, and how the content is performing. 
  • Are plugged into internet culture: You instinctively know what will resonate, and you can connect macro trends to what’s relevant to Gary’s brand.

What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ene

Home to t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, Seattle punches far above its weight in innovation. But its surrounding mountains, sprinkled with world-famous hiking trails and climbing routes, make the city a destination for outdoorsy types as well. Established as a logging town before shifting to shipbuilding and logistics, the Emerald City is now known for its contributions to aerospace, software, biotech and cloud computing. And its status as a thriving tech ecosystem is attracting out-of-town companies looking to establish new tech and engineering hubs.

Key Facts About Seattle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
